ADU Rental Restrictions: Glendale vs Pasadena

How do adu rental restrictions rules compare between Glendale, CA and Pasadena, CA?

Glendale and Pasadena have similar restriction levels.

Glendale, CA

Los Angeles County

Heavy Restrictions

Glendale ADUs may be rented long-term (30 days or more) without a separate license. Short-term rentals under 30 days are prohibited in ADUs citywide under Glendale Municipal Code Chapter 5.56 (Home-Sharing License and Prohibition of Vacation Rentals) and the ADU Covenant Agreement recorded at permit issuance. State law (Gov. Code §65852.2(a)(7)) also restricts STR use of ADUs permitted after January 1, 2020.

Pasadena, CA

Los Angeles County

Heavy Restrictions

Pasadena ADUs permitted after January 1, 2020 must be rented for terms of 30 days or more under California Government Code §65852.2(a)(7). Short-term rental of ADUs is generally not available because PMC §17.50.296 (Ordinance No. 7317) requires the host to occupy the property as a primary residence for at least nine months per year, and prohibits vacation rentals citywide. ADUs covered by Pasadena's Measure H rent stabilization (built before Feb 1, 1995, or otherwise within scope) may also have rent-cap obligations.

Glendale FAQ

Can I rent my Glendale ADU on Airbnb?

No. GMC Chapter 5.56 prohibits short-term rentals (under 30 days) in ADUs citywide, and the ADU Covenant Agreement recorded at permit issuance enforces the 30-day minimum. Glendale's Home-Sharing License is hosted-stay only and ADUs are not eligible.

Is there any short-term option for an ADU?

No. Even Glendale's hosted Home-Sharing program excludes ADUs. Hotel and motel uses are land-use classifications restricted to commercial zones via conditional use permit, not available in residential districts.

Pasadena FAQ

Can I rent my Pasadena ADU on Airbnb?

Generally no. PMC §17.50.296 requires the host to occupy the property as a primary residence for at least 9 months per year and prohibits vacation rentals citywide. ADUs permitted after January 1, 2020 must also be rented for 30 days or more under Cal. Gov. Code §65852.2(a)(7). Long-term tenancy is the standard path.

Does Pasadena rent control apply to ADUs?

Possibly. Pasadena's Measure H (City Charter Article XVIII, effective Dec 22, 2022) covers most residential properties built before February 1, 1995 with rent caps and just-cause eviction protections. Whether a specific ADU is covered depends on the parcel's building history — consult the Pasadena Rental Housing Board for a unit-specific determination.
